What shipped in every YEKE release. The list matches image tags that were actually deployed — the next one shows up here as Coming soon before it ships.

Pin the tag in your installation, don't use latest: the agent version the core installs is derived from core's own tag. All published tags are on Docker Hub.

0.7.3

Live 12 Aug 2026
  • Port-forward now works for Services too (svc/<namespace>/<name>), not just Pods.
  • The Port-forward button is now in both the Pod and Service list action menu.

0.7.1

12 Aug 2026
  • Destructive operations now stand out in the operations log with a marker in the Status cell.
  • Added a one-time sign-in step before port-forwarding (yeke login <origin>).

0.7.0

12 Aug 2026
  • New: Port-forward. Approved access to a local port from the CLI (@nairotech/yeke-cli); it goes through the approval chain but isn't treated as destructive.

0.6.0

10 Aug 2026
  • The agent now builds from its own public repository (nairotech/yeke-agent).
  • The tunnel protocol shipped as its own package (@nairotech/yeke-tunnel).

0.5.2

9 Aug 2026
  • The interface was redesigned: new visual language, bulk actions (multi-select, one approval for multiple targets).
  • Monitoring: pod and node metrics, historical charts (1h · 6h · 24h · 7d).
  • Hook integration: asking your own system before an operation is applied.
  • Adding machines and provisioning: building a cluster from bare servers, pinning the SSH host key.
  • The interface now speaks English too; role-based permissions shipped with built-in roles.
